The Movie
Bladerunner (1982)
Directed by Ridley Scott, featuring Harrison Ford, Rutger Hauer and Sean Young, this film is loosely based on Philip K. Dick's 1968 novel Do Androids Dream of Electric Sheep?. The film is set in a dystopian future Los Angeles of 2019, in which synthetic humans known as replicants are bio-engineered by the powerful Tyrell Corporation to work at space colonies. When a fugitive group of advanced replicants led by Roy Batty (Hauer) escapes back to Earth, burnt-out cop Rick Deckard (Ford) reluctantly agrees to hunt them down.This film is 1 hour 57 minutes and rated M (not recommended for children under the age of 15).
